Job summary

Mountain-Capital-Partners in Flagstaff, AZ seeks an experienced ski/snowboard instructor supervisor to lead our SRS team, oversee staff training and daily operations, and ensure safety and guest satisfaction across all programs.

Responsibilities include budgeting, staff development, and coordinating with leadership to meet quality and safety targets while staying current on industry standards.

Qualifications

  • 3 years as a full-time ski/snowboard instructor or supervisor (Preferred)
  • Minimum of 5 years in the outdoor industry
  • Previous experience of managing a minimum of 100 people (Preferred)
  • PSIA/AASI Member in Good Standing (Level 3 Preferred)

Responsibilities

  • Lead the SRS team in recruiting, hiring efforts, professional development of all employees and direct oversight of SRS adult & children’s programs.
  • Provide feedback and connect employees with appropriate training, growth and leadership opportunities.
  • Financial management of all operations, including budget, operating expenses, payroll, and revenue through product development and performance.
  • Track, monitor, and analyze labor to revenue.
  • Know where the SRS stands financially as part of overall company performance.
  • Oversee information presented on SRS landing pages at snowbowl.ski
  • Monitor Guest Research scores / feedback and act upon them and provide excellent guest service in daily interactions while addressing guest concerns
  • Work with Leadership across departments to support and achieve quality, financial, and safety targets.
  • Provide guidance for training to create and implement a plan and monitor the quality of training.
  • Communicate effectively across departments to ensure staff training matches the intended outcomes, program coordination is smooth with all operating groups and ensure safety and organization
  • Stay current on guest and employee health and safety regulations, including MSDS standards, universal precautions, child abuse guidelines, temporary background checks, emergency evacuation and lightning procedures.
  • Know and model the school teaching system and guest service guidelines and be prepared to lead clinics and teach the public when necessary.
  • Actively seek information about industry trends, competitions, and events, and remain involved with professional organizations including ISIA, PSIA/AASI.
  • Promote and emphasize safety in all classes.
  • Understand and oversee instructor daily paperwork
  • Help to diffuse tense situations such as upset guests or instructors, or confrontations
